Assertion : The sustaining surface for the gliding in certain animals, is a fold or series of folds of the skin known as patagium .
Reason : The gliding flights are performed by erboreal animals.

A

If both the assertion and reason are true statement and reason is correct explanation of the assertion .

B

If both the assertion and reason are true statement but reason is not a correct explanation of the assertion .

C

If the assertion is true but the reason is a false statement.

D

If both assertion and reason are false statements.

Text Solution

AI Generated Solution

The correct Answer is:
**Step-by-Step Solution:** 1. **Understanding the Assertion**: The assertion states that the patagium is a fold or series of folds of skin that serves as a sustaining surface for gliding in certain animals. This is true. The patagium is indeed a membranous structure that aids in gliding, found in animals such as bats, flying squirrels, and flying lizards. 2. **Understanding the Reason**: The reason provided states that gliding flights are performed by arboreal animals. Arboreal animals are those that primarily live in trees. While some arboreal animals may glide, not all of them do. Gliding is a specific form of movement that is not exclusive to arboreal animals. 3. **Evaluating the Truth of Both Statements**: - The assertion is true because the patagium does function as a gliding surface. - The reason is false because it inaccurately generalizes that all gliding flights are performed by arboreal animals. Not all gliders are arboreal; for example, flying fish glide over water. 4. **Conclusion**: Since the assertion is true and the reason is false, the correct answer is that the assertion is true, but the reason is false. **Final Answer**: The correct option is that the assertion is true, but the reason is false. ---
